What license do you need for Med Surg travel nurse jobs in Michigan?

To work Med Surg travel nurse jobs in Michigan, you must hold an active RN license. Michigan is not currently part of the Nurse Licensure Compact (NLC), so out-of-state nurses must apply for licensure by endorsement to work in Michigan.

Michigan Board of Nursing

Contact information

Website: https://www.michigan.gov/lara/bureau-list/bpl/health/hp-lic-health-prof/nursing

Phone: 517.335.9700

Fees

License by Exam: $54

License by Endorsement: $54

Renewal: $123.60

Fingerprinting: $60 Temporary License: $10

Timing

Processing Time: 6 – 8 weeks

Valid for: 2 years

Renewal Schedule: 2 years

General Information

Nurse Licensure Compact: No

Nursys: No

CEU Requirements: CEU Requirements: 25 hours with at least 2 hours in pain and symptoms management

What are the highest-paying cities for Med Surg travel nurse jobs in Michigan?

Based on current travel job openings, the top 5 highest-paying Med Surg travel nursing cities in Michigan are:

  • West Bloomfield Township up to $2,060 Weekly
  • Jackson up to $1,965 Weekly
  • Kalamazoo up to $1,938 Weekly
  • Marquette up to $1,891 Weekly
  • Petoskey up to $1,848 Weekly
How much do Med Surg travel nurse jobs in Michigan pay?
Med Surg travel nurses jobs in Michigan pay an average of $1,891 per week, with Med Surg travel nursing jobs in Michigan ranging from $1,838 to $2,060 per week.
